====== Clipping Procedure ========= source : https://www.jonipsaro.com/post/krios/ ==== Before starting ==== * Fill a liquid nitrogen transfer dewars. Make sure it dry before beginning * Assemble the necessary tools: * Flat-T autoloader forceps * C-clip holder wands (one per grid) * Rings and C-clips (one per grid) * Screwdriver * all part of the transfer station for grid clipping: * Table-top cryo dewar (and cover) * Aluminum & brass specimen transfer pedestal * circular platform aimed holding wands ====Load C-clips into the holder wands.==== * 1. Use forceps and firm pressure to insert a single C-clip into the wand. * Make sure that the C-clip is hugging the inside wall of the wand. * Use forceps to adjust if necessary. * 2. To align the C-clip at the tip of the wand. * a. ++Hold the wand vertically by positionning it into the circular opening of the brass part of the transfer base.|

Inspect proper placement of the C-clip =====Prepare the transfer station setup====== Arrange the transfer setup as pictured. It should include the specimen transfer pedestal, loaded C-clip wands, and autoloader forceps. Additionally, place clip rings (flat-side down) in each of the four mounting positions in the brass portion of the transfer pedestal. Inspect each clip ring to make sure that the clip side is face-up. Once clip rings are in place, rotate the brass disc such that all clips are covered. This will ensure they do not move while cooling the station. Place cryo-EM grid box(es) on the sample pedestal. Open them using the grid box fastener wand. Keep the grid box top attached to the fastner wand until needed.
